Welcome to this stunning 2-bedroom, 2-bathroom condo offering over 800 sq ft of thoughtfully designed living space. This bright and modern unit features a rare wrap-around balcony with unobstructed, breathtaking views of Lake Ontario, the downtown skyline, and the iconic CN Tower. The open-concept layout is complemented by a sleek, open concept kitchen, perfect for both everyday living and entertaining. Floor-to-ceiling windows fill the space with natural light, enhancing the spectacular panoramic views from every angle. modern building with premium amenities, this unit offers the perfect blend of comfort and lifestyle. Enjoy the convenience of being steps to shops, restaurants, and scenic waterfront walking trails right at your doorstep.

Humber Bay, Toronto is a west Toronto neighbourhood notable for its university grads, executives, business, science and education, law & public sector professionals and tradespeople. Residents with a significant number of adults aged 25 to 44 and seniors aged 65 to 69.
